Salah Speculation Reaches Turkey
One of the most striking transfer stories to emerge involves former Liverpool forward Mohamed Salah. Multiple sources report that Turkish club Trabzonspor have begun talks to sign the Egypt international, with a separate ESPN report describing Salah as being in talks to join the club. If a move materialises, it would represent one of the more surprising switches in recent memory, taking one of the Premier League's most celebrated players of the last decade to Turkey's top flight.

Tennis: Draper's Emotional Montreal Exit
On the ATP Tour in Montreal, the headlines tell of an emotional moment for the British player, Jack Draper, who was seen in tears amid an injury concern during his defeat. It was a difficult chapter for a player who has shown so much promise on the circuit.
